The Vista Ridge Wolves will take on the Highlands Ranch Falcons at 6:00 p.m. on Tuesday. Keep an eye on the score for this one: the two teams posted some lofty point totals in their previous games.
Vista Ridge is headed in fresh off scoring the most points they have all season. They came out on top in a nail-biter against Harrison last Saturday, sneaking past 74-71. The win made it back-to-back victories for the Wolves.

Ben Arnold was nothing short of spectacular: he went 8 for 11 on his way to 20 points and eight rebounds. Those eight rebounds gave him a new career-high. The team also got some help courtesy of Zay Thurman, who posted eight points and four steals.
Meanwhile, Highlands Ranch was not able to break out of their rough patch on Saturday as the team picked up their third straight defeat. They fell 75-62 to Arapahoe. While losing is never fun, the Falcons can't take it too hard given the team's big disadvantage in MaxPreps' Colorado basketball rankings (they are ranked 61st, while the Warriors are ranked 13th).
Vista Ridge will need focus on slowing down Zach Benner, one of several Highlands Ranch players who made an impact when they last played. He went 5 of 10 on his way to 18 points. The team also got some help courtesy of Mason Lane, who had 15 points and seven rebounds.
Highlands Ranch's loss dropped their record down to 6-5. As for Vista Ridge, their victory bumped their record up to 3-6.
